Mississippi State offensive lineman Kwatrivious Johnson was arrested Monday and charged with malicious mischief after allegedly vandalizing a car in Starkville.
Despite the arrest, during his media availability leading up to the Bulldogs’ game Saturday night against NC State, MSU coach Mike Leach said that he expected to have Johnson available against the Wolfpack.
And it appears as if that remains the plan, as Johnson, who is a starter at right guard, has joined his teammates on the field for warmups.

Johnson, a 6-7, 320-pound redshirt junior, appeared in 8 games and made 3 starts for the Bulldogs in 2020.
The Greenwood, Mississippi native was a highly touted recruit for Mississippi State, having been ranked as a 4-star prospect by the 247Sports composite and the No. 294 overall prospect in the nation in the 2018 class.
